Editor’s Note About BPA in Activewear

Bisphenol A (BPA) is a chemical found in some types of plastic. Research has shown that exposure to high levels of BPA can lead to obesity, hormonal imbalances, and uterine cancer, among other health complications. 

On May 18, 2023, building on its findings from last fall, the Center for Environmental Health (CEH) announced that, after testing, it found high levels of BPA in certain activewear pieces containing blends of polyester and spandex. California law states that your skin can safely absorb up to 3 micrograms of BPA daily. CEH found that some leggings, sports bras, shorts, and athletic shirts may expose wearers to over 120 micrograms in a day, according to CNN. 

CEH found high levels of BPA in sports bras from Sweaty Betty, leggings from Nike, Athleta, Champion, Patagonia, and Kohl’s, shorts from Champion, Nike, and Adidas, and athletic shirts from Fabletics. We may recommend some of these products or similar items from these brands in this list, as these products have not been recalled and the science on transdermal absorption of BPA is still not settled. As a precaution, it is best to limit the amount of time you spend in activewear by changing out of it when you are finished working out.

What to Look For in Zip Front Sports Bras

Support Level

Choosing a sports bra with the proper support level is vital for not only comfort and focus but to avoid any potential injuries during your workout. “Without the proper support, you're just asking for your breast tissue to break down,” says Marcellus, “The Cooper's ligaments in your breast will stretch, and then they’ll start to hang and sag. You definitely want as much support as you possibly can.” 

If you plan on participating in high-impact workouts, like running or plyometrics, opt for a high-support zip-front sports bra. And for low-impact workouts, like yoga or walking, choose a medium- or light-support bra. 

Support Type

Encapsulation sports bras hold each breast in a separate cup, while compression bras secure both breasts against your chest, restricting movement. Some sports bras offer a combination of the two. According to a study published by the International Journal of Environmental Research and Public Health, women prefer compression bras—and second to this preference was a combination of both, leaving encapsulation as the least popular option for support type. 

Material

There are several factors to look for regarding the material of zip-front sports bras. Choosing a four-way stretch garment that will hug your curves and move with you comfortably is important, says Velandia. She also recommends a featherweight material that feels like a second skin and antimicrobial fabric that will keep you odor- and stain-free. 

While 100-percent cotton may feel breathable, it holds in moisture for a very long time—which is not ideal for post-workout sweat, Velandia says. So it’s best to avoid cotton when you can and look for zip-front sports bras made of moisture-wicking performance fabrics like polyester and nylon. 

Fit

Finding the perfect fit is essential to keep you comfortable, committed, and confident during a workout. A sports bra should be snug but not constricting. You shouldn't really notice it, but the bra should hold you nicely, Marcellus says.

Straps

Zip-front sports bras come in many different strap designs, and choosing which one is right for you depends on your own personal preferences. Some may prefer a racerback style for a more supportive fit, while others prefer a strappy style for a trendier look. 

Whichever design you choose, it's important to ensure that the straps don’t distract from your workout. You want to avoid any fidgeting or messing with straps that are digging into your back or falling off your shoulders. You want the bra to feel like a part of you, says Schembri.

Adjustability

Some zip-front sports bras are made with adjustable straps and back closures. This is a great feature for customizing fit, support, and coverage during your workouts.

Frequently Asked Questions

  • When should I wear a sports bra?

    It's a good idea to always wear a sports bra when exercising, says Marcellus, because the support is different from a regular bra and essential for that kind of movement. To avoid straining, hanging, sagging, and even pain, opt for a sports bra during all types of workouts—from low to high impact.

  • How should a sports bra fit?

    A well-fitting sports bra should be snug, but not too constricting. It will fit tighter than a regular bra and shouldn’t have any gaps or extra room. Most of the support comes from the band, which should be wide enough to avoid uncomfortable compression. To prevent distraction during your workouts, your sports bra should feel like a second skin, and you should rarely even notice it's there. 

    “It's like when you wear an outfit that's fussy—you spend all your time at the party adjusting your belt or pulling your skirt down—it's really distracting from your ability to focus on what you’re doing. It's the same concept with a sports bra,” Marcellus says. 

  • How do I measure myself for a sports bra?

    First, measure your band size. Using a measuring tape, measure your rib cage right where the band of a bra would sit. 

    Then, measure your bust size. Measure around the fullest part of your breasts with the measuring tape.

    Finally, calculate your bra size. Subtract your band size from your bust size—the difference tells you your cup size (0=AA, 1=A, 2=B, 3=C, and so on).

    For example, if your band size is 36 inches and your cup size is 38 inches, your bra size is 36B.
